Analysis

Djibouti recorded 12,910 FAO, tonnes for cereal food aid deliveries in 2012.

The figure is up 83.1% on the previous year and down 16.1% over ten years.

Over the whole period, cereal food aid deliveries in Djibouti peaked at 25,530 FAO, tonnes in 1988 and was at its lowest, 6,025 FAO, tonnes, in 2003.

That places Djibouti 24th out of 54 countries with data for 2012, putting it in the middle of the range.

The long-run direction has been consistently falling across the 25 years of available data.

Food aid shipments represent a transfer of food commodities from donor to recipient countries on a total-grant basis. Processed and blended cereals are converted into their grain equivalent by applying the conversion factors included in the Rule of Procedures under the 1999 Food Aid Convention to facilitate comparisons between deliveries of different commodities. For cereals, the period refers to July/June, beginning in the year shown.
